Literature summary extracted from

  • Qiao, Y.; Peng, Q.; Yan, J.; Wang, H.; Ding, H.; Shi, B.
    Gene cloning and enzymatic characterization of alkali-tolerant type I pullulanase from Exiguobacterium acetylicum (2015), Lett. Appl. Microbiol., 60, 52-59.

Inhibitors

EC Number Inhibitors Comment Organism Structure
3.2.1.41 2-mercaptoethanol 5 mM, 51% residual activity Exiguobacterium acetylicum
3.2.1.41 Cu2+ 5 mM, 67% residual activity Exiguobacterium acetylicum
3.2.1.41 EDTA 5 mM, 72% residual activity Exiguobacterium acetylicum
3.2.1.41 Mg2+ 5 mM, 90% residual activity Exiguobacterium acetylicum
3.2.1.41 SDS 5 mM, 46% residual activity Exiguobacterium acetylicum

Metals/Ions

EC Number Metals/Ions Comment Organism Structure
3.2.1.41 Co2+ 5 mM, 198% of initial activity Exiguobacterium acetylicum
3.2.1.41 Fe2+ 5 mM, 121% of initial activity Exiguobacterium acetylicum
3.2.1.41 Mn2+ 5 mM, 136% of initial activity Exiguobacterium acetylicum
